Skip to content

Inject multiple tweaks into IPAs without a jailbreak using Scarlet

Notifications You must be signed in to change notification settings

shrayus-masanam/Scarlet-Injector

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

5 Commits
 
 
 
 
 
 

Repository files navigation

Scarlet Injector

Normally, Scarlet only lets you inject one tweak into an app through the installation process. This program creates a simple Scarlet JSON repo that will let you inject as many tweaks as you want into an IPA with Scarlet.

The repo houses the user-supplied IPA's download URL along with the URLs of all dylib/deb files that the user specifies. The JSON data is uploaded to Ghostbin and will persist for 14 days. Once the app is installed onto the device, the repo can be safely removed and the app will stay installed & refresh/resign when needed.

To use, simply run python3 main.py, and input direct URLs to the target IPA and dylib/deb files when asked. Then, once the program gives you a Ghostbin URL, paste that URL into Scarlet as if it were a repo. You will then see a single app that you can install, and while installing it Scarlet will inject the tweaks into the app.

About

Inject multiple tweaks into IPAs without a jailbreak using Scarlet

Topics

Resources

Stars

Watchers

Forks

Languages